Transaction d62641567eadefd631a5442963627d95d9fd165b98997df9ff7dc1364844db7c
1 Input
1 Output
-
d62641567eadefd631a5442963627d95d9fd165b98997df9ff7dc1364844db7c:0
- value
- 626132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aee394a259fb3a044f42e3cd80053d0c67e91d1b OP_EQUAL
- address
- 3Hdk8VwGTZACN2Ai199gHetcGxhpf4qeXb